FMEA and RCM Failure Mode Risk Management Fundamentals is a comprehensive video course where you can learn how to do FMEA and developing the Reliability Centered Maintenance ecosystem for your business.
I have handcrafted this course to allow students to acquire core fundamental knowledge on FMEA and RCM as well as how to apply it in real business applications.
If you are currently or working towards being a reliability or maintenance professional, you will find this course of great help to get the fundamental knowledge you need to kick start your professional career. If you own or work inside an engineering consulting firm, this course will provide you with the tools to effectively and efficiently produce an effective RCM business plan for your clients.
